Rush for ag-chem megadeals clogs regulatory path, worries farmers

WASHINGTON/CHICAGO, May 19 (Reuters) - As Bayer AG joins the agricultural sector's scramble to consolidate, its bid for Monsanto Co may be a tipping point for U.S. farmers, federal lawmakers and regulators concerned the tie-ups may harm the farm economy.
